Book excerpt: Masters Theses in the Pure and Applied Sciences was first conceived, published, and disseminated by the Center for Information and Numerical Data Analysis and Synthesis (CINDAS) * at Purdue University in 1 957, starting its coverage of theses with the academic year 1955. Beginning with Volume 13, the printing and dissemination phases of the activity were transferred to University Microfilms/Xerox of Ann Arbor, Michigan, with the thought that such an arrangement would be more beneficial to the academic and general scientific and technical community. After five years of this joint undertaking we had concluded that it was in the interest of all con cerned if the printing and distribution of the volumes were handled by an interna tional publishing house to assure improved service and broader dissemination. Hence, starting with Volume 18, Masters Theses in the Pure and Applied Sciences has been disseminated on a worldwide basis by Plenum Publishing Cor poration of New York, and in the same year the coverage was broadened to include Canadian universities. All back issues can also be ordered from Plenum. We have reported in Volume 32 (thesis year 1987) a total of 12,483 theses titles from 22 Canadian and 176 United States universities. Book Forced flow Chromatographic Determination of Calcium and Magnesium with Continuous Spectrophotometric Detection

Download or read book Forced flow Chromatographic Determination of Calcium and Magnesium with Continuous Spectrophotometric Detection written by and published by . This book was released on 1977 with total page pages.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Modifications to the forced-flow chromatograph include a flow-through pH monitor to continuously monitor the pH of the final effluent and an active low-pass filter to eliminate noise in the spectrophotometric detector. All separations are performed using partially sulfonated XAD-2 as the ion exchanger. Elution of calcium and magnesium is accomplished using ammonium chloride and ethylenediammonium chloride solutions. Calcium and magnesium are detected by means of Arsenazo I and PAR-ZnEDTA color-forming reagents. Other metal ions are detected by means of PAR and Chromazurol S color-forming reagents. Calcium and magnesium distribution coefficients on partially sulfonated XAD-2 as functions of ammonium chloride and ethylenediammonium chloride concentration are given together with distribution coefficients of other metal ions. Methods for the selective elution of interfering metal ions prior to the elution of calcium and magnesium are described. Beryllium and aluminum are selectively eluted with sulfosalicylic acid. Those elements forming anionic chloride complexes are selectively eluted with HCl-acetone. Nickel is selectively eluted with HCl-acetone-dimethylglyoxime. Synthetic samples containing calcium and magnesium, both alone and in combination with alkali metals, strontium, barium, beryllium, aluminum, transition metals, and rare earths, are analyzed. Hard water samples are analyzed for calcium and magnesium and the results compared to those obtained by EDTA titration, atomic absorption spectroscopy, and plasma emission spectroscopy. Several clinical serum samples are analyzed for calcium and magnesium and the results compared to those obtained by atomic absorption spectroscopy.

Book Determination of Anions in High Purity Water by Ion Chromatography

Download or read book Determination of Anions in High Purity Water by Ion Chromatography written by JA. Rawa and published by . This book was released on 1981 with total page 13 pages.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Characterization of high-purity waters is a classic analytical problem because of lack of sample integrity as well as inaccuracies in the analytical methods employed for measurement. For industrial process water applications, the purity of water with low dissolved solids content has been traditionally determined by on-line monitoring of specific conductance and sodium. Trace concentrations of cations (sodium, potassium, calcium, and magnesium) present in demineralizer effluents, condensates, and high-pressure boiler and boiler feedwaters have been determined by flame or flameless atomic absorption. Previously, there was no accurate method for measuring trace concentrations of anionic constituents. The introduction of a new analytical technique, ion chromatography (IC), has facilitated the identification and quantitation of several anions--chloride, nitrate, orthophosphate, and sulfate at the micrograms-per-litre level. The IC technique incorporates the concepts of ion exchange and conductimetric detection. Without sample pretreatment, these anions can be accurately detected down to about 50 ?g/litre with a 100-?l sample injection.
